Why do security guards quit?

Security guards quit due to factors such as low pay, irregular or long shifts, lack of advancement opportunities, and challenging working conditions. Job dissatisfaction and burnout are common reasons for leaving the role, especially when proper training and support are lacking.

What is the difference between Home Based Guard Shack Security vs Mobile Patrol Security?

AspectHome Based Guard Shack SecurityMobile Patrol Security
CredentialsSecurity guard license, basic trainingSecurity guard license, vehicle operation training
Work EnvironmentStationed at a fixed guard shack, on-sitePatrolling multiple locations, on the move
Employer & Industry UsageIndustrial sites, gated communities, construction sitesCommercial properties, industrial complexes, event security

Home Based Guard Shack Security involves stationary security personnel stationed at a fixed guard shack, primarily monitoring a specific location. In contrast, Mobile Patrol Security requires patrolling multiple sites, often using a vehicle. Both roles typically require similar security credentials but differ in work environment and scope of patrols.

What is the highest paid security guard job?

The highest paid security guard jobs are typically in executive protection or close protection roles, often involving high-profile clients or corporate executives. These positions may require specialized training, certifications, and experience, and can offer higher salaries compared to standard security guard roles, especially when working in high-risk or high-security environments.

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Perform security patrols of designated areas on foot or in vehicle
  • Watch for irregular or unusual conditions that may create security concerns or safety hazards
  • Sound alarms or calls police or fire department in case of fire or presence of unauthorized persons
  • Warn violators of rule infractions, such as loitering, smoking, or carrying forbidden articles
  • Permit authorized persons to enter property and monitors entrances and exits
  • Observe departing personnel to protect against theft of company property and ensures that authorized removal of property is conducted within appropriate client requirements
  • Investigate and prepare reports on accidents, incidents, and suspicious activities; maintain written logs as required by the post
  • Aid customers, employees, and visitors in a courteous and professional manner
  • Make emergency notifications as necessary pursuant to site Post Orders
